Educators at Northwestern University Medical School and the University
of Washington School of Medicine originally developed the Nutrition
Attitudes Survey (NAS) for the Nutrition Academic Award. The survey
is intended to measure the views of medical students and clinicians-in-training
on the role of nutrition and preventive medicine in patient care.
The NAS is administered at the University of Texas Medical School
at Houston to first year students during orientation and to fourth
year students at the beginning of 4th year clerkship. The
